华为云国际站代理商充值:CDN加载jQuery的优化与应用
随着网站和应用程序的复杂度增加,前端加载速度的优化逐渐成为提高用户体验和搜索引擎排名的关键因素之一。尤其是常见的前端资源库如jQuery,如何优化其加载速度,成为众多开发者关注的重点。对于使用华为云的用户来说,利用华为云的内容分发网络(CDN)加速jQuery的加载,不仅能提升网页性能,还能进一步优化网站的全球访问速度。本文将结合华为云的优势,探讨如何利用CDN优化jQuery加载,并通过华为云服务器产品来提升整体服务性能。
一、华为云CDN概述
华为云的内容分发网络(CDN)是一种通过分布在全球的节点服务器,将内容缓存并加速用户访问的技术。华为云CDN在全球范围内布设了大量的节点,能够大幅提升用户从不同地区访问网站的速度。其核心优势包括:
- 全球节点分布:华为云在全球主要地区和国家都部署了CDN节点,确保全球用户都能享受到极速的访问体验。
- 智能调度:通过智能调度算法,华为云CDN能够自动选择最优节点,确保用户的请求能够被最快响应。
- 安全防护:华为云CDN支持DDoS攻击防护、Web应用防火墙等安全功能,有效保障网站安全。
- 低延迟、高带宽:通过优化的网络架构,华为云CDN提供低延迟的快速响应,极大提升用户体验。
二、为什么需要CDN加载jQuery?
jQuery是一个广泛使用的JavaScript库,几乎所有网站都会加载它。尽管如此,jQuery文件的加载速度仍然是优化网站性能的一个重要环节。如果不采用CDN进行加速,用户每次访问时都需要从原始服务器获取这些资源,可能会导致加载缓慢,特别是对于跨国访问的用户来说,延迟更加明显。
使用CDN加速jQuery的加载有以下几个显著优势:
- 全球加速:CDN通过全球分布的节点,将jQuery文件缓存到离用户最近的服务器,大大减少了传输距离和延迟,提升了加载速度。
- 提高缓存命中率:CDN节点缓存了常用的前端资源,包括jQuery库,避免每次都从源服务器拉取,减少了带宽消耗。
- 减少源站负担:通过将jQuery等静态资源放到CDN节点上,减轻了源站服务器的负担,提升了网站整体的响应能力。
- 提高用户体验:快速的资源加载直接提升了页面加载速度,减少了用户等待时间,提高了用户留存率和满意度。
三、如何在华为云CDN上加载jQuery?
在华为云CDN上加速jQuery的加载,流程相对简单,下面将详细说明操作步骤:
- 创建华为云CDN加速域名:首先,你需要在华为云控制台中创建CDN加速域名。登录华为云账号,进入CDN管理页面,选择“域名管理”并添加一个新的加速域名。
- 上传jQuery文件:将jQuery的静态资源文件上传到CDN节点。可以选择将jQuery上传至对象存储(OBS)中,并通过CDN进行加速,或者使用公共CDN加速库。
- 配置CDN缓存规则:为确保jQuery文件被高效缓存,可以在CDN控制台配置缓存策略。设置合理的缓存过期时间,并确保静态文件不会频繁更新,提升缓存命中率。
- 修改网站资源引用路径:在网页代码中,将jQuery的引用路径修改为CDN加速后的URL。例如,将“http://yourdomain.com/jquery.min.js”改为通过华为云CDN加速后的URL。
- 测试与监控:完成配置后,可以通过浏览器或开发者工具检查资源是否通过CDN加速加载。华为云CDN提供了丰富的日志和监控工具,帮助用户实时了解加速效果。
四、华为云服务器与CDN的结合使用
除了使用华为云CDN加速前端资源加载,华为云的服务器产品(如弹性云服务器、云数据库等)也能够与CDN进行深度集成,进一步优化网站的性能和稳定性。
例如,网站的动态内容(如用户信息、交易数据等)仍然需要通过服务器进行处理。华为云的弹性云服务器能够根据实际流量自动扩容,确保即使在高并发情况下,服务器性能依旧稳定。同时,CDN加速静态资源的加载,减轻了云服务器的压力,使得服务器能够集中处理动态内容。
华为云还提供了全链路加速解决方案,包括图片、视频等大流量资源的加速,帮助网站在全球范围内提升响应速度。
五、华为云CDN的优势与案例分析
在全球化的互联网环境中,华为云CDN的优势愈发明显。以下是几个使用华为云CDN的成功案例:
- 全球电商平台:通过使用华为云CDN,某全球电商平台成功减少了页面加载时间,提升了用户购物体验,特别是在欧美地区,用户体验显著提升。
- 在线教育平台:该平台通过华为云CDN加速课程视频和教学资料的加载,大幅降低了因网络延迟导致的卡顿现象,提高了学生的学习效率。
- 新闻网站:华为云CDN帮助该新闻网站加速文章和图片的加载,用户访问速度提升了40%,在新闻热点期间,服务器压力也得到了有效分担。
总结
随着互联网用户需求的不断增加,网站性能优化变得愈发重要。华为云CDN为开发者提供了一种高效的解决方案,不仅能够加速静态资源的加载,还能在全球范围内提供低延迟的访问体验。通过将jQuery等常见的前端库托管在CDN上,网站的加载速度将大大提升,从而为用户带来更好的体验。
此外,华为云的弹性云服务器、云数据库等产品,与CDN的结合使用,进一步提升了网站的稳定性和处理能力,保证了在高并发场景下的平稳运行。对于代理商来说,利用华为云平台的全球网络优势,可以有效提升服务质量,为客户提供更优质的产品体验。
发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/242595.html